Preview: Cray Valley

With two finals in successive years behind the Fleet, Josh Wright’s side embark on another GoCardless Kent Senior Cup season with a first ever competitive visit to Cray Valley (Paper Mills), managed by former skipper Steve McKimm.

The visit to the Artic Stadium is our first away draw in the competition since going to Folkestone in 2022 – Fleet have played eight county cup ties at the Kuflink Stadium since then.

Fleet warmed up for last season at the stadium in Eltham back in July 2024, winning 5-1 against the then Isthmian Premier newcomers.

Former Tonbridge boss McKimm has led quite the revolution at the Millers since his appointment in summer 2023. In his first season, the side lost only one league game as they coasted to the Isthmian South-East title with a +71 goal difference and a run to the First Round of the FA Cup where they held Charlton Athletic to a 1-1 draw at The Valley before bowing out in the replay.

Last season, their first at Step 3, Cray Valley finished in fourth place and just missed out on a play-off final thanks to a late Dartford revival in the semi-final.

The campaign so far in 2025/26 has been a little more tricky, with the Millers sitting in 16th place, having won three and lost five – and they were well beaten in an FA Cup replay by Tonbridge by 5-0. They have, however, emerged victorious in four of their last seven games in all competitions.

Former Fleet defender Marvel Ekpiteta is Cray Valley’s most familiar face while ex-Bromley midfielder Danny Waldren has returned to playing with the club after leaving his manager’s post at Beckenham Town.

Cray Valley have beaten Ashford this and last season in the Kent Senior Cup but last season lost in Round 2 at Dover.
